Subject: DR drill recap + sort-stability bug

Team — quick notes for the weekly sync. During Thursday's disaster-recovery drill for Gridelm, we confirmed the report builder loses sort stability after failover: rows with equal keys reorder nondeterministically, which broke two reconciliation checks. Fix is to switch the merge step to a stable sort; Perrin owns it for next sprint. Drill itself passed otherwise — failover in 11 minutes. To access the drill environment snapshot, use the recovery passphrase noted below.

strongbox words: oliath-framir

Welcome, plugin authors! The Splitgate assignment service is what your plugin calls to learn which experiment variant a visitor belongs to. Assignments are deterministic per visitor key, so repeated calls always return the same bucket. Your plugin should cache the response for the session and never compute buckets locally. The full API contract, rate limits, and sandbox instructions for Splitgate are published on the page below.

wiki page, tahaf-tajog: https://jira.ordindyn.corp/pipeline

The Trundle parcel-tracking service emits delivery-status events to our Kestrelpoint webhook endpoint. Each payload is signed, and our handler rejects anything with a missing or invalid signature header. Replay protection uses a five-minute timestamp window, configurable via `TRUNDLE_REPLAY_WINDOW`. For review purposes, note that all inbound events are logged to the audit stream before processing. Signature verification requires the shared signing secret, so the service's environment file must contain the following line:

sealed setting: VAULT_KEY5=54f99

// REINDEX_BATCH_CAP limits docs per shard pass in the Tallowfield
// nightly search reindex. Raising it starves the ingest queue;
// lowering it overruns the maintenance window. 5000 is the tested
// sweet spot. Change only with a soak run. Verified against the
// build noted below.

session token of bawif-hahog = htk6_ac5981

Ticket: The waveform preview in Soundquill renders uploaded audio client-side, but the peaks file is fetched from a user-controllable path param. Flagging for security review — looks like a potential path traversal into the Bramleigh asset store. We sanitized the obvious cases but want a second pair of eyes before the 2.9 cut. The candidate build's token is right below.

session token of bawep-yadup = htk21_528abd376e3c5a4ec24a1